Don't Try To Use Fake Documents For Asset Protection
People facing possible judgments that jeopardize their wealth are often in desperate situations; desperate people sometimes do desperate things to protect themselves. When people consult attorneys about asset protection they sometimes find that they do not have available the best legal documents to substantiate exempt ownership or to protect their business LLC or corporations. Later, the client reports that the correct documents have "been found" in their business or personal papers. Sometimes existing documents are actually found, but sometimes non-existing documents are manufactured and back-dated. I heard of a case this week where a "found" document lead to severe adverse consequences in litigation.
